Yoni Komorov
Yoni Komorov is the Director of
Research at The S. Daniel Abraham Center for Middle East Peace. Prior
to joining the
Center, he was based in Palm Beach, Florida and served as Chief of
Staff to the Chairman, S. Daniel Abraham. In this capacity, Mr. Komorov
assisted Mr. Abraham with his various ventures and also traveled
extensively to the Middle East, accompanying the Chairman on his track
II diplomatic efforts.
Mr. Komorov served as an officer in the
Israel Defense Forces and moved to the United States in 2002 after
completing his service in the IDF. During his academic studies he
worked as a legislative intern at the House Subcommittee on the Middle
East and Central Asia and was also a research assistant for the Middle
East Peace Project at the University of Miami. Mr. Komorov graduated
from the University of Miami in 2006 with a bachelor’s degree in
International Relations.
